Sometimes reinstalling a program fixes everything —
but only if you do it the right way.
Let’s go through how to cleanly reinstall software to fix bugs, crashes, and slowdowns.
✅ 1. Uninstall properly first
-
Use Revo Uninstaller or Geek Uninstaller
-
Remove all leftover files, folders, registry entries
-
Don’t just delete the shortcut — uninstall completely
✅ Clean removal prevents old errors from coming back.
✅ 2. Clean leftover files
Manually delete:
-
C:\Program Files\[Program Name]
-
C:\Users\[YourName]\AppData\Local\[Program Name]
-
C:\Users\[YourName]\AppData\Roaming\[Program Name]
✅ No junk = smoother reinstall.
✅ 3. Download the latest installer
-
Always use the official website
-
Check for newer versions or patches
⚠️ Avoid third-party download sites — risk of malware.
✅ 4. Install with fresh settings
-
Choose Custom Install (not Express)
-
Opt out of toolbars or extra software
-
Let it create new configuration files
✅ Don’t reuse old corrupted settings if avoidable.
✅ 5. Restart after reinstall
Some programs need a reboot to fully re-register:
-
Services
-
Drivers
-
File associations
✅ Restart ensures a complete, clean installation.
